What is This Channel-Based Messaging Platform?

At its core, Slack is a powerful communication tool built for modern teams. Imagine a digital workspace where conversations are neatly organized into dedicated channels, rather than being buried in endless email threads. Each channel can be created for a specific project, team, topic, or client, ensuring that relevant discussions and files are always easy to find. This intuitive structure helps to streamline information flow, reduce distractions, and keep everyone on the same page.

Beyond its channel-centric approach, this platform integrates a suite of features designed to enhance daily workflows. From direct messaging for private conversations to robust file sharing capabilities, it aims to reduce reliance on fragmented communication tools. Key Features and Benefits for Your Team

The platform offers a comprehensive set of functionalities tailored to boost team efficiency:

  • Organized Channels: Create public or private channels for specific projects, teams, or discussions. This keeps conversations focused and ensures that information is readily accessible to those who need it.
  • Direct Messaging: For quick, one-on-one, or small group conversations, direct messages offer a private way to connect with colleagues.
  • File Sharing and Collaboration: Easily share documents, images, and videos. The platform allows for comments on shared files, turning them into collaborative assets.
  • Powerful Search: Never lose an important piece of information again. Its comprehensive search function allows you to find past messages, files, and links across all your channels and direct messages.
  • App Integrations: Connect your favorite tools, such as Google Drive, Asana, Zoom, and countless others. This creates a unified workflow, reducing the need to switch between multiple applications.   • Voice and Video Calls: Jump on a call with a colleague or your entire team directly within the platform, making spontaneous discussions and quick meetings effortless.
  • Customizable Notifications: Control what notifications you receive and when, helping you stay focused while remaining informed about important updates.
